Director, Software EngineeringDirector, Software EngineeringMastercard's Business Experimentation & Optimization (BEO) program is seeking a Director, Software Engineering to lead the design, delivery, and evolution of our data platforms, analytics capabilities, and customer-facing solutions. This leader will be responsible for a global engineering organization that develops and operates the end-to-end data and analytics ecosystem powering customer insights and decision-making.
The role will initially focus on leading teams responsible for data ingestion, data engineering and data pipelines, custom analytics, and insight delivery, partnering closely with Product, Data Science, Analytics, and business stakeholders to deliver scalable, high-quality solutions that create measurable customer and business value. Over time, this leader will expand their scope to assume ownership of key customer-facing products and experiences, helping shape the future vision and technology strategy for the BEO platform.
As part of the Services Technology organization, BEO is undergoing a significant technology transformation to modernize how we generate and deliver insights to our customers. This is a highly visible technical leadership opportunity to drive innovation through cloud-native platforms, modern data architectures, AI-enabled capabilities, and emerging technologies including agentic workflows. The successful candidate will play a critical role in shaping the next generation of experimentation, analytics, and insight delivery capabilities across the platform.
This hybrid role is based in Arlington, VA and requires three days per week onsite. The leader will manage a global organization of approximately 25 engineers and engineering leaders, including 4–5 direct reports across the United States, India, and Europe. Success in this role requires strong technical leadership, working with ambiguity in a rapidly changing ecosystem, stakeholder management, and the ability to drive execution across globally distributed teams.
